What to Look for in Men's Medical Scrub Tops: A Guide to Comfort and Practicality

WINK W123 Men's V-Neck Scrub Top

If you work in healthcare, veterinary medicine, or any field requiring medical scrubs, finding the right scrub top matters more than it might seem. A well-fitted, functional scrub top can genuinely improve your comfort during long shifts, while a poor choice can leave you frustrated and exhausted. This guide walks you through what to consider when buying men's medical scrub tops, using the WINK W123 as a reference point for what quality features actually look like.

Understanding Men's Medical Scrub Tops and Why They Matter

Medical scrub tops are designed specifically for healthcare environments. Unlike regular t-shirts, they're built to withstand frequent washing, offer practical storage for tools and instruments, and allow freedom of movement during physical work. A men's medical scrub top serves as your uniform, your toolkit holder, and your comfort layer all at once. Key Features That Make a Difference

When evaluating any men's medical scrub top, several features consistently affect real-world performance. Fabric composition matters significantly. The WINK W123 uses microfiber polyester with 4-way stretch capability, meaning the fabric moves with you in multiple directions rather than restricting movement. This kind of stretch fabric becomes particularly valuable during physically demanding shifts.

Pocket placement and quantity directly impact your workflow. The WINK W123 includes four pockets strategically distributed: a chest pocket with a utility loop, two side entry pockets, a shoulder badge loop, and a sleeve pocket with a pen slot. Think about what you actually carry during shifts. Do you need quick access to a pen, badge, or small instruments? The more thoughtfully pockets are positioned, the less time you waste searching for essentials.

Vented sides represent another practical feature worth understanding. Venting improves airflow, which matters during physically active shifts or in warmer environments. The WINK W123 incorporates vented sides along with a longer back panel, which keeps coverage where you need it most, even when reaching or bending.

Fit and Size Selection for Men's Scrubs

Getting the right size in a men's medical scrub top involves more than just knowing your shirt size. Medical scrubs are tailored differently than casual wear. Look for sizing that accommodates your actual proportions rather than forcing you into standard street clothing dimensions. The WINK W123 is described as tailored for various shapes and sizes, which means the cut itself accounts for different body types rather than assuming everyone fits one template.

When ordering, consult the specific sizing chart for the WINK brand rather than assuming your usual size. Men's scrub tops should allow comfortable movement through the shoulders and chest without excess fabric bunching at the sides. If you find yourself constantly tugging or adjusting, the fit isn't right. Similarly, sleeve length matters. Sleeves that fall mid-bicep work better than those that reach your wrist during patient care or clinical work.

Fabric Care and Durability Considerations

Medical scrubs endure harsh laundry conditions. Frequent washing, hot water, and commercial detergents are part of healthcare life. Microfiber polyester, as used in the WINK W123, handles this better than many natural fabrics because it resists fading, maintains shape, and dries quickly. The quick-dry quality isn't just a convenience feature; it means you can have clean scrubs ready faster.

To extend the life of any men's medical scrub top, follow care instructions consistently. Turn pockets inside out before washing to prevent seam stress. Separate by color when possible. Avoid fabric softeners, which can reduce the effectiveness of the stretch fabric. The WINK W123's construction should handle regular institutional laundry, but treating it with respect still matters.

Practical Considerations Before You Buy

Think about your work environment's dress code. Some facilities have color requirements or specific uniform standards. The WINK W123 is available in various colors, so confirm which options meet your workplace needs. Consider how many scrub tops you need to rotate through. Having at least two or three clean tops reduces laundry stress and ensures you always have something ready.

Your personal preference for neckline matters too. The WINK W123 offers a V-neck, which some find cooler and less restrictive than crew necks. Try different styles if possible to see what you prefer during actual work.

Choosing a men's medical scrub top involves balancing comfort, function, and durability. The WINK W123 men's V-neck scrub top addresses these fundamentals through thoughtful design. Focus on finding a top that fits properly, contains the pockets you actually need, and uses fabric that withstands your specific work environment. That's what makes the real difference in your daily comfort.
